Handover note — Crumbwheel order cutoffs.

Welcome aboard. The bakery cutoff rule in Crumbwheel closes same-day orders at 14:00 local to each storefront, not UTC — this has bitten us twice. Holiday overrides live in the calendar service and take precedence silently, so always check there first when a cutoff looks wrong. To unlock the calendar service's admin console after a restart, enter the recovery passphrase below.

vault phrase of bagap-bahaf = silion-pelox-sorox-casdor-quenwyn-fraax-eliox-praael-kelion-quenvan-kasox-rusael-norius-belvan

## Ownership

The clock-skew monitor for the Quarrylight build farm lives in this repo. Build agents occasionally drift more than the 250ms tolerance, which breaks artifact timestamp ordering and causes the Slatebird scheduler to mark runs as flaky. If support sees skew alerts, first check the NTP sidecar logs, then escalate rather than restarting agents manually — restarts mask the drift without fixing it. Questions about the monitor, its thresholds, or the escalation path go to the component owner listed below.

account owner for kagag-yahap: Novath Quenok

**Vendor note: Inkmill markdown pipeline**

Rendering for Parchway docs is outsourced to Inkmill under an annual contract, renewing each March. They handle sanitization and PDF export; we own the upload queue. SLA: 4-hour response on rendering failures. Escalate only after two failed retries. Their support desk is reachable at the address below.

billing contact of hahaf-baguf = zorael.tammir.jorius@sivrelhq.internal

## Formula sandbox tuning

User-supplied formulas in Gridmoor execute inside a restricted interpreter with hard ceilings on time, memory, and call depth. Reviewers should confirm any change to these ceilings is justified in the PR description, since raising them widens the abuse surface. Defaults were chosen from production traces. The current limits are as follows.

limits module of tafog-fawip:
WEIGHTS = {
    "julix": 57,
    "lamys": 992,
    "kasvan": 209,
    "quenok": 750,
    "alddor": 259,
    "oliath": 1009,
    "wenix": 815,
}